Kenwright: Forget Portsmouth dramas, Everton need billionaire
Kenwright: Forget Portsmouth dramas, Everton need billionaire
11.03.10 | tribalfootball.com
Everton chairman Bill Kenwright insists he is desperate to bring in new investment.
Kenwright rubbishes claims that Portsmouth's plight is a sign that mega rich owners are not the way for clubs like Everton to go.
“The truth is Everton do need a billionaire” he told the Liverpool Echo. “Of course that’s a stock phrase, but we do need major investment.
“One of the difficulties of being a chairman who has had to use money as wisely as he possibly knows how, is that it’s hard when you get bombarded, as I have been in the last three AGMs, with questions like “Why can’t we have what Newcastle have? West Ham? Portsmouth?”
“I even got Notts County last year. A former Everton employee had gone there and evidently there was some rumour mill that I turned down Arab millions beforehand.”
